Similar to my other Tensegrity Table, but with a better looking design. I woke up one day and kind of saw this in my head, so I modeled it as soon as possible. Still looking for the time to print it out, but I'm sure it won't cause too much trouble as there are no steep overhangs.
How to assemble
Materials:
- 3 longer strings -- outer
- 1 shorter string -- center
- 1 base -- I recommend the ring, there's no need for the extra filament in the middle
- 1 top -- Orient this model 180° for printing, the file comes as assembled (upside-down)
1.) Start with choosing a suitable center string length, and getting that slotted in, making sure that the arm of the top does not drop below into the ring of the base. This will give you an idea of the length of string needed for the outer tensioners.
